What Does an Electrical Safety Evaluation Cover?
The useful scope of an electrical evaluation depends on the question you are trying to answer: a recurring symptom, older equipment, future capacity, a planned addition, or another electrical concern.
Ask what was observed, what options are available, what conditions could affect scope, and what the next practical step would be. The goal is a clear home-specific explanation.
This is not presented as a universal certificate, real-estate inspection, or blanket code determination.
